I suspect (educated guess...) that the FADEC senses IEPR on a Roller.
On an RB211, it does sense integrated EPR. The 777 Trent seems to be simplified, however. It only measures fan inlet pressure (P2.0) and the low pressure/hot turbine exhaust pressure (P5.0).

This seems unusual to me as most of the thrust comes from the fan exhaust, not the core.

P2.0 probes are heated. Failure of heating would be evident on the flight deck (but failures like this simply don't happen at the same time... and even if both heaters failed, the crew would still be able to power up the engines)
Probe heat is monitored by both channels of the EEC. On the 777, probe heat is activated at 5% N1 (rather than 50% N3 on the RB211)
